Friday, September 19, 2008, 9:30 am to 12:00 pm
More Blessed to Give than to Receive?  Practical Aspects of Gift Processing
Patrick Scott, Gary Geer, and Shanna Schaffer, Thomas Cooper Library, USC

A practical workshop on the issues in assessing, selecting, and handling gifts and gift collections.   Issues discussed will include aims and expected outcomes for gift programs, initial gift assessment, common donor questions and expectations, acknowledgement procedures, post-donation gift processing, researching gifts and handling gift appraisal (including IRS gift-in-kind tax requirements as they affect libraries), special issues in book resale gift programs, and related library program and development opportunities.  You will get the opportunity for hands-on review of “typical” donated materials, and you will receive hand-outs on helpful resources and guidelines.
